Ingredients You’ll Need
- 1.5 kg (3.3 lb) boneless skinless chicken thighs: Chicken thighs are ideal for slow cooking as they remain incredibly moist and tender. Using boneless, skinless thighs simplifies the process and maximizes flavor absorption.
- 240 ml (1 cup) low-sodium chicken broth: Provides the liquid base for the sauce and adds savory depth. Opting for low-sodium allows you to control the overall saltiness of the dish.
- 120 ml (½ cup) apple cider vinegar: Adds a crucial tanginess that balances the sweetness and mimics the acidity found in bourbon.
- 120 ml (½ cup) pure maple syrup: Contributes a natural sweetness and a subtle caramel flavor, essential for replicating the bourbon glaze. Ensure you use *pure* maple syrup, not pancake syrup, for the best flavor.
- 80 ml (⅓ cup) soy sauce (low sodium preferred): Provides umami and saltiness, enhancing the savory notes of the chicken. Low-sodium soy sauce is recommended to manage the salt content.
- 60 ml (¼ cup) freshly squeezed orange juice: Brightens the sauce with a citrusy note and adds a touch of sweetness. Freshly squeezed is best for optimal flavor.
- 5 ml (1 tsp) liquid smoke: This is the key ingredient for achieving that smoky, bourbon-like flavor without using alcohol. A little goes a long way!
- 5 ml (1 tsp) alcohol-free vanilla extract: Adds a subtle warmth and complexity, complementing the other flavors and enhancing the overall depth.
- 2 tbsp (30 ml) tomato paste: Contributes richness, depth of flavor, and helps to thicken the sauce.
- 2 tsp (10 ml) smoked paprika: Enhances the smoky flavor profile and adds a beautiful color to the sauce.
- 1 tsp (5 ml) ground black pepper: Provides a subtle spice and enhances the overall flavor.
- 1 tsp (5 ml) ground ginger: Adds a warm, slightly spicy note that complements the other flavors.
- 2 cloves garlic – minced: Essential for adding aromatic depth and savory flavor.
- 1 tbsp (15 ml) cornstarch mixed with 2 tbsp (30 ml) water – slurry for thickening: Creates a smooth and glossy glaze by thickening the sauce at the end of cooking.
- 2 tbsp (30 ml) chopped fresh parsley – bright green garnish: Adds a fresh, vibrant element and a pop of color.
- 1 tsp (5 ml) toasted sesame seeds – contrast garnish: Provides a subtle nutty flavor and a textural contrast.
Ingredient Substitutions
While this recipe is designed to deliver a fantastic bourbon-style flavor without alcohol, here are a few substitutions you can make if needed:
- Maple Syrup: You can substitute with brown sugar, but reduce the amount slightly (about ¾ cup packed) as brown sugar is more intense.
- Soy Sauce: Tamari (gluten-free) or coconut aminos can be used as alternatives.
- Liquid Smoke: If you don’t have liquid smoke, you can add a pinch of smoked salt, but it won’t provide the same depth of flavor.
Detailed Cooking Instructions for Slow Cooker Bourbon Style Chicken
- Prepare the Chicken: Begin by patting the 1.5 kg (3.3 lb) of boneless, skinless chicken thighs dry with paper towels. This step is crucial! Removing excess moisture allows the chicken to brown slightly and absorb the flavors of the sauce more effectively. Cut the thighs into bite-sized pieces – approximately 1-inch cubes are ideal. Place the cut chicken directly into the bottom of your 4-quart (3.8 L) slow cooker.
- Whisk Together the Sauce: In a large bowl, combine the 240 ml (1 cup) of low-sodium chicken broth, 120 ml (½ cup) of apple cider vinegar, 120 ml (½ cup) of pure maple syrup, 80 ml (⅓ cup) of soy sauce (low sodium is preferred to control saltiness), 60 ml (¼ cup) of freshly squeezed orange juice, 5 ml (1 tsp) of liquid smoke, 5 ml (1 tsp) of alcohol-free vanilla extract, 2 tbsp (30 ml) of tomato paste, 2 tsp (10 ml) of smoked paprika, 1 tsp (5 ml) of ground black pepper, 1 tsp (5 ml) of ground ginger, and 2 minced garlic cloves. Whisk vigorously until the sauce is completely smooth and all ingredients are well incorporated. A smooth sauce ensures even coating and flavor distribution.
- Coat the Chicken: Pour the prepared sauce evenly over the chicken in the slow cooker. Ensure that every piece of chicken is thoroughly coated with the sauce. Gently stir the contents of the pot to distribute the aromatics and ensure consistent flavor throughout.
- Slow Cook to Perfection: Cover the slow cooker and cook on LOW for 6-8 hours, or on HIGH for 3-4 hours. The chicken is ready when it is fork-tender and easily shreds with minimal effort. Cooking on LOW for a longer period yields the most tender and flavorful results, allowing the flavors to meld beautifully.
- Thicken the Sauce: About 15 minutes before the end of the cooking time, prepare a cornstarch slurry by mixing 1 tbsp (15 ml) of cornstarch with 2 tbsp (30 ml) of cold water. Stir the slurry into the slow cooker, ensuring it’s well combined. Replace the lid and continue cooking for an additional 5-10 minutes, or until the sauce thickens to a glossy, glaze-like consistency. The cornstarch slurry acts as a natural thickening agent, creating a rich and appealing sauce.
- Final Touches & Rest: Taste the glaze and adjust seasoning as needed. A pinch of salt or a splash more soy sauce can enhance the flavor balance. Once satisfied, remove the slow cooker from heat and let it rest for 5 minutes. This allows the flavors to settle and the sauce to thicken further.
- Serve & Garnish: Transfer the Slow Cooker Bourbon Style Chicken to a shallow serving bowl. Spoon any remaining glaze generously over the chicken. Immediately sprinkle with 2 tbsp (30 ml) of chopped fresh parsley and 1 tsp (5 ml) of toasted sesame seeds for a vibrant and flavorful garnish.
Why This Recipe Works: The Science of Flavor
This Slow Cooker Bourbon Style Chicken achieves its signature flavor profile through a careful balance of sweet, savory, and smoky elements. The maple syrup provides natural sweetness, while the soy sauce delivers umami and saltiness. Apple cider vinegar adds a subtle tang that cuts through the richness, and the liquid smoke imparts a delicious, smoky depth reminiscent of bourbon-aged flavors – all without any alcohol! The vanilla extract enhances the sweetness and adds a subtle complexity. Slow cooking allows these flavors to meld together over time, resulting in incredibly tender and flavorful chicken.
Tips for the Best Slow Cooker Chicken
- Don’t Overcrowd: Ensure the chicken is in a single layer as much as possible. Overcrowding can lead to uneven cooking.
- Low and Slow is Key: While the HIGH setting is faster, the LOW setting consistently produces the most tender and flavorful results.
- Adjust Sweetness: If you prefer a less sweet sauce, reduce the amount of maple syrup slightly.
- Spice it Up: For a touch of heat, add a pinch of cayenne pepper or a dash of hot sauce to the sauce.

The Role of Liquid Smoke in Alcohol-Free “Bourbon” Flavor
Achieving a “bourbon” style flavor without alcohol requires clever ingredient substitutions. Liquid smoke is the star here! It provides that characteristic smoky aroma and flavor associated with oak-aged bourbon. Combined with the maple syrup and vanilla, it creates a complex flavor profile that mimics the warmth and depth of a traditional bourbon sauce. Using high-quality liquid smoke is essential for the best results – look for brands that use natural wood smoking processes.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
- Can I use chicken breasts instead of thighs? While you can use chicken breasts, thighs are recommended for their tenderness and flavor. Chicken breasts may become dry during slow cooking.
- Is this recipe gluten-free? Yes, this recipe is naturally gluten-free, but be sure to use a gluten-free soy sauce.
- Can I make this ahead of time? Absolutely! You can prepare the sauce and marinate the chicken overnight for even more flavor.
